Output eabc37bbfdd124062f108f548a01e9214616a04976a5e2343ce854ea7912a2d7:1

value
18970
script pubkey
OP_0 OP_PUSHBYTES_20 82d590dafa3cb1b338dfd50d58fbaaf26e08de72
address
tb1qst2epkh68jcmxwxl65x437a27fhq3hnje3ddr6
transaction
eabc37bbfdd124062f108f548a01e9214616a04976a5e2343ce854ea7912a2d7